Immortal Valentine is a tiefling ranger and brewer that curently resides in Saltmarsh.  

History

Valentine was born in 1470 on the streets of Neverwinter. When he was three, he was adopted by Marza and Lephi Valentine, two women who owned an herb shop that was also the cover for an underground fighting arena. When Valetine was a teenager, he ended up joining the Tortle's Labyrinth Guild, a group of Neveren-based treasure hunters and explorers, where he honed his skills to become a ranger.   In Kythorn of 1496, Valentine was forced to kill a long-time member of the guild, Daldor, after he became enraged and attacked Valentine for seemingly no reason. Valentine couldn't find any cause of the attack, besides a strange new spiral tattoo on Daldor's neck. Disturbed, Valentine left to find the symbol's origin.   In Elient of 1496, Valentine, while traveling Northwest Faerun, arrived in Saltmarsh alongside two other travelers: the half-elf wizard and younger sister of Micah Pierce, one of the Heroes of Saltmarsh, Seraphina Pierce and the shadar-kai oathbreaker paladin Raven Bloodash. Unbeknowst to the new arrivals, the town was in the middle of a crisis, as one of its council members, Anders Solmor, was using the recent departure of the Neverwinter Guard garrison to fight in the Battle of the Spire as a call to action for the Marshers to throw the Neverens out of town. Aiding Anders was the shadow monk Bo Latarn, who was attacking Marshers at night to raise tensions and fear.   However, Valentine and the other new arrivals found and fought Bo Latarn, forcing him to flee to Anders' manor. Valentine was able to track the monk's path, and the group aprehended Bo and Anders, resulting in the former being hanged and the latter arrested.   With no real plans, Valentine opted to stay in town with Raven and Sera, and all three of them rented rooms at the Snapping Lure and spent most evenings drinking on the first story. Shortly after their regular drinking nights, the group was joined by Ardek Oredelver, the younger brother of Mogran Oredelver, one of the Heroes of Saltmarsh, and occasionally by Oceanus, one of the Heroes in his own right. This group decided to informally codify themselves as the B-Team, short for the Beer Team.   On the 1st of Uktar in 1496, Seraphina and Micah came to blows when after the Heroes of Saltmarsh were approached by the renowned thief the Mask to partner in raiding the Twilight Monastery. The Mask had also, years before, stolen Micah and Sera's childhood home, resulting in Micah going on a bull-headed pursuit after them, abandoning his family. Sera was furious that Micah kept this from her, as well as his recently acquired warlock powers, and Raven and Valentine came out to support their new friend, especially after the Heroes decided to work with the Mask.   Shortly after the Heroes left, Oceanus, who had stayed behind, tried to cheer up Sera by taking the group on an adventure in the Mere of Dead Men to determine the reason why a few members of the Sunny Shore Tribe had gone missing. The B-Team discovered and defeated a burgeoning cult of Myrkul, allowing Valentine to show off their impressive ranger abilities in the swamp, but Sera was not cheered up and hated the entire experience.   In Nightal of 1496, the Heroes decided to bring the B-Team up-to-speed about the true goings on in Saltmarsh, explaining the threat posed by the aboleth S'gothgah and the mind-dominating Banesmark. Believing that a powerful ancient dwarven soul trap, called the God Trap, could disrupt the aboleth's plans, Micah, Mogran, and Lyra planned to steal it from the black dragon Voaraghammanthar in the Mere of Dead Men, taking Valentine with them due to his expertise navigating swamps.   Together with the other Heroes, Valentine helped kill Voaraghamanthar, freeing the Scaly Death Tribe tribe in the process. When Valentine returned with the other Heroes to Saltmarsh, they were informed that the group that stayed behind had accidentally released the vampire Xolec from his hidden prison. The Heroes of Saltmarsh and the B-Team worked together to lure out Xolec and kill him, first by forcing him to flee and then locating his coffin near the town's standing stones, ending him for good.   Valentine and the other members of the B-Team remained in Saltmarsh while the Heroes left for the Styes for their final confrontation with S'gothgah, protecting the town if anything should happen to it while they were gone.   Following the Banesmark Crisis, Valentine headed back to his parents to try and figure out what to do with his life now that he was wealthy from the dragon's hoard. Inspired by his adopted parents, Valentine began studying brewing, returning to Voaraghamanthar's lair to collect rare materials before setting up a brewery in Saltmarsh.   Though it took many trial and errors, Valentine now has a succesfully brewing company that sells to the local taverns. Drinks of his include "Black Dragon Acid Liquor," "Triton Saltwater Beer, "Yuan-Ti Ritual Cider," and more. All of them are sold under the "Valentine's" label.
